What is Hippity Hop To The Barber Shop?


1.

A slang phrase used to express the desire for someone else to leave. Roughly equialent to telling someone to get the hell out.

First known occurance of the phrase was on the U.S. sitcom "Scrubs", said by Dr. Cox when telling Elliot Reed to leave

Dr. Cox: Get out of here, go ahead, go, go, hippity hop to the barber shop
